About the Role
As a Banking Associate specializing in business loans, you will support lending operations and focus on the diverse needs of business clients.
Responsibilities
- Engage customers via proactive outbound calling to assist with banking inquiries and lending eligibility.
- Raise awareness of Tyro’s banking solutions in every interaction.
- Assist with banking inquiries and advise on processes for clients interested in banking, accounts, and lending.
- Cross-sell and refer EFTPOS opportunities to the sales & account management team.
- Build strong relationships with business clients, creating advocates and helping repeat borrowers.
- Work closely with risk and product teams to ensure customer needs are met.
- Collect financials for manual assessment.
- Assist in vetting applicants by conducting preliminary reviews of financial documents and credit history.
- Perform basic credit analyses to evaluate creditworthiness of business loan applicants before risk submission.
- Monitor the quality of funded loans, including default rates, to maintain a healthy loan portfolio.
- Stay informed about industry trends, market conditions, and competitor offers.
- Provide customer and business insights back to internal stakeholders.
- Perform ad hoc duties to assist with customer inquiries, initiatives, projects, and campaigns as directed by your manager.

About the Company
- Tyro provides integrated payments, banking, and lending solutions to ensure Australian business success.
- With over 21 years of experience, Tyro combines people, technology, and partners to deliver simplified payments and seamless business banking.
- Tyro powers over 76,000 merchants and works with almost 800 partners across hospitality, retail, services, and health sectors.
